Arrangements should be in place for the safe evacuation of employees, visitors and contractors in the event of a fire alarm.

A risk assessment should be carried out to determine the frequency the evacuation procedure is tested. 

If normal working hours are carried out in the workplace (9am - 5pm), fire drills should be held at least every 12 months. If shift work is carried out or if there is a high turnover of staff fire drills should be conducted on a more frequent basis.

After the fire drill a debriefing session should be held in order to highlight or rectify any problems identified. A record of the fire drill should also be kept.
